PART A – ESSAY WRITING [30 MARKS]
Answer one question only from this part. – Your composition should be about 250 words long.
Credit will be given for clarity of expression and orderly presentation of material.
- Your friend has relocated and left your current school. He or she wrote to you seeking to know if any changes have taken place in the school and why. Reply to his/her letter.
To answer this question, the following format will be followed.
- Writer’s address
- Date
- Salutation
- Introduction
- Body
- Conclusion
- Subscription.
The letter will have a friendly tone; jargon and/or nicknames will be used; contracted forms of words will be used; and the language will be informal and friendly.

Suggested Solution to BECE English Language Mock Exam Essay Questions (Friendly Letters)—Set 2
Koofori D/A JHS,
P.O. Box KO22,
Koforidua, E/R.
20th November, 2025
Dear Kweku,
It’s been a while since you left, and Charlie, the place hasn’t been the same. I really miss our small jokes and how you always teased me about my handwriting. Your letter made me feel you were still around.
You asked if anything has changed in school, and herrh, plenty has happened. Things aren’t like before at all. Let me give you the full gist.
The first big change is that we have a new headmistress. She’s very strict but cool. She wants discipline everywhere and doesn’t joke with lateness. Morning assembly now starts exactly at 7:00 a.m., and if you’re late, you sweep the whole frontage. Because of this, everyone rushes to school early.
Another change is the way lessons are taught. The teachers are using project work now. We even do group presentations every Friday. It makes learning fun, but bro, the work is plenty. You remember how we used to dodge homework? Now you can’t even try that trick.

The third change is that the school field has been repaired. The grass is green and smooth, and we have new goalposts. Training after school has become sweet. I know you miss football, but forget it; the place is now proper.
So, my guy, these are the changes. You should visit during vacation. We all miss you here. Do well to reply to this letter. Let me know the facilities in your new school that we do not have. Please do not lie and create them. Lol.
Yours sincerely,
Kobby

Solve These Five Friendly-Letter Practice Questions
-
Your best friend moved to another region last term.
Write a letter to him/her describing your new class, your teachers, and how school life has changed. -
Write a letter to your elder sister who lives abroad.
Tell her about your upcoming BECE, how you are preparing, and the kind of support you need from her. -
Your cousin has stopped attending school regularly.
Write a friendly letter advising him/her on why education is important and encourage him/her to return. -
Write a letter to a friend in another school telling him/her about a sports event your school recently held, what you enjoyed most, and why the event was memorable.
-
Your friend has invited you to spend part of the vacation with him/her, but your parents refused.
Write a letter explaining why you cannot come, how you feel, and what you hope will happen next time.
